In observance of the Holy Month of Ramadhan, the City Government of Isabela under the leadership of Mayor Sitti Djalia Turabin-Hataman with Basilan Lone District Representative Mujiv Hataman held the “Iftar sin Pagdakayu,” April 17, at the JW Strong Boulevard, Barangay Port Area, this city.
The gathering was graced by chairpersons of Barangays, city government officials, bangkeros from Island barangays in Malamawi, vendors and other sectors involve in the day to day operations at the James Walter Strong Boulevard.
In her message at the start of the Ramadhan, Mayor Turabin-Hataman urged the Muslim faithful in Isabela City to use the occasion to reflect on the values of charity, generosity, and solidarity to live a life of peace and harmony. Invoking an inclusive governance, the Turabin-Hataman administration has annually hosted Iftars for various sectors with the aim of forging stronger communal ties and understanding among Isabeleños of various denominations.
Iftar is the evening meal with which Muslims end their daily Ramadhan fast at sunset. The day’s fasting ends at the time of the call to prayer for the evening prayer. This is the second meal of the day; the daily fast during Ramadhan begins immediately after the pre-dawn meal of suhur and continues during the daylight hours, ending with sunset with the evening meal of Iftar.
